"We had a large crowd. It ended up turning into a fight and stabbing. One guy was cut and one guy was stabbed in the throat," said Chief Nelson Baird of the Coats Police Department.
The stabbings left bloodstains on a door. The brawl also left holes in walls and gang graffiti in a men's restroom.
Police say the crowd swelled to about 300 people, well above the center's capacity.
"It was total chaos. We couldn't determine the victims from the suspects," Baird said.
No arrests have been made.
Baird says no one is talking and he is worried the fight may have sparked a gang war in a town that currently has two police officers.
